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Ошибка при выводе символов -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Переставить каждую пару строк матрицы таким образом, чтобы первой была строка с меньшей суммой элементов http://www.cyberforum.ru/cpp-beginners/thread1770923.html
Дана матрица размером 12х4. В прямоугольной матрице, имеющей чет-ное количество строк, переставить каждую пару строк (1,2)(3,4) и т.д. таким образом, чтобы первой была строка с меньшей суммой...
C++ Как инициализировать массив ссылок? //--------------------------------------------------------------------------- #include <stdio.h> #include <conio.h> #pragma hdrstop #include <tchar.h>... http://www.cyberforum.ru/cpp-beginners/thread1770916.html
C++ Записать числа в массив
Всем привет. Никак не могу найти решение. Есть массив с определенным набором чисел, которую перезаписываем в другой массив, кроме элементов попадающих в отрезок . Не могу понять как исключить эти...
C++ Получить нормаль из трёх точек
Допустим у меня есть 3 точки в пространстве (0,0,1), (0,1,0), (1,0,0) т.е. треугольник. 1. Мне нужно найти нормаль этого треугольника. 2. Получить из нормали нормализованный вектор. 3. Найти средину...
C++ Найти фальшивую монету за заданное количество взвешиваний http://www.cyberforum.ru/cpp-beginners/thread1770824.html
Недавно узнал про эту известную задачку, написал тестовую кату на одном сайте компьютерных задачек (на Haskell), теперь хотел бы предложить желающим решить ее на С++. Имхо интересно ее решить...
C++ Передача массива в качестве аргумента функции В общем нужно передать массив в качестве аргумента без указания его размера, чтобы в дальнейшем присвоить все его содержимое другому массиву) int main() { char a = "abcd"; int i =... подробнее

Показать сообщение отдельно
jester
0 / 0 / 0
Регистрация: 18.03.2016
Сообщений: 27
Завершенные тесты: 1

Ошибка при выводе символов - C++

26.06.2016, 11:45. Просмотров 147. Ответов 2
Метки (Все метки)

Не отображается русскими буквами текст который я ввожу. Помогите, пожалуйста)
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#include <iostream>
#include <string> 
#include <sstream>
using namespace std;
int main()
{
    setlocale(LC_ALL,"Rus");
    string wrd,str, str2, hello="hello"; 
    cout<<"Введите строку:"<<endl; 
    getline(cin,str);
    istringstream ss(str);
    ss>>str2;
    str2+=' '+hello+' ';
    while(ss>>wrd)
        str2+=wrd+' ';
    cout<<str2<<endl;
    system ("pause");
    return 0;
}
Ошибка при выводе символов
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
#include <iostream> 
#include <cstring> 
using namespace std; 
int main ()
{
setlocale(0,"");
struct strc { char fio[50]; int tn[50]; int chm[50];  double t[50]; double zp[50]; } mstud[50]; 
int n, i;
cout << "Введите количество работников фирмы: "; cin>>n; cout<<endl;
for (i=0;i<n;i++)
{
    cout<<"Введите ФИО: "; cin>>mstud[i].fio;
    cout<<"Введите Табельный номер: "; cin>>mstud[i].tn[i];
    cout<<"Введите количество отработанных часов в месяц: "; cin>>mstud[i].chm[i];
    cout<<"Введите почасовой тариф работника: "; cin>>mstud[i].t[i];
    cout<<endl;
}
for (i=0;i<n;i++)
    mstud[i].zp[i]=mstud[i].chm[i]*mstud[i].t[i];
for (i=0;i<n;i++)
    cout<<mstud[i].fio<<" "<<mstud[i].zp[i]<<endl;
system ("pause");
return 0;
}
Ошибка при выводе символов
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ru